Talk with your doctor about what to expect. You should be able to sit up in bed within a couple of hours. You might have a little pain, but you can have medicines to help ease pain. You should be able to eat a normal diet.
You'll need to move around carefully as advised. Your doctor will tell you if you need to not do any specific movements. For example, you may be told to not bend your neck. You also may need a soft or hard neck collar if the surgery was in your neck.
